Mitsubishi Heavy targets $27 million in sales for solar power equipment

3 October 2003 - Japan's Mitsubishi Heavy Industries expects to double its sales of solar power generation equipment over two years. It predicts an expansion in sales from Germany to the whole of Europe, including Switzerland, Italy and France.

Mitsubishi Heavy is targeting sales of about 3 billion yen ($27m) for its solar power generation equipment in fiscal 2004. This sales figure represents a 50 per cent jump from fiscal 2002.

In Japan, it will expand sales by making use of its own air conditioner sales network and by joining forces with homebuilders and construction material manufacturers in developing new products.
